AI Summary

  • Creates the In-Person Absentee Voting Expansion Grant Program within the State Election Board to provide financial assistance to county election boards for additional in-person absentee voting sites during November statewide elections in even-numbered years

  • Grants of $25,000 each will be awarded beginning July 1, 2027, to cover staffing, facility rental, equipment, security, and administrative costs for each approved voting location

  • County eligibility is tiered by size: counties with 400,000+ registered voters may receive up to 6 grants; 100,000+ voters up to 5 grants; 50,000+ voters up to 4 grants; and counties with 25,000+ voters or covering 1,500+ square miles up to 2 grants

  • Establishes the In-Person Absentee Voting Expansion Grant Program Revolving Fund in the State Treasury as a continuing fund not subject to fiscal year limitations

  • Grant applications must include proposed location justification based on population distribution, travel distance, access needs, expected voter turnout, and a staffing and security plan

Legislative Description

Elections; creating the In-Person Absentee Voting Expansion Grant Program. Effective date.
